Mission Statement
Back to Humanity (BTH) is a New York City based non-profit whose mission is to facilitate holistic rehabilitation for sex trafficking survivors.
Description
Back to Humanity provides resources essential for professional development, healing and empowerment.
We advocate that true rehabilitation addresses the mind, body and spirit and that only a multi-faceted approach can begin to repair the extensive physical and psychological trauma faced by survivors. Effects can range from depression to Post-Traumatic Stress Disorder. Unfortunately, there is a lack of necessary resources available to help facilitate holistic rehabilitation, and therefore Back to Humanity has developed meaningful programs to support survivors.
